Da Silva's double helps JDT to FA Cup final win

KUALA LUMPUR: Johor Darul Ta'zim (JDT) won the FA Cup title after overcoming Terengganu 3-1 at the National Stadium in Bukit Jalil today.

Terengganu must thank their goalkeeper Rahadiazli Rahalim for keeping the score down by denying JDT on several occasions.

In front of 85,000 fans, JDT took the lead through Arip Aiman Hanapi in the 35th minute. The winger outwitted a Terengganu defender before beating

Rahadiazli with a powerful drive after receiving a pass from Bergson da Silva.

Hector Bidoglio's side extended the lead when Da Silva scored from the penalty spot in the 60th minute.

Terengganu, however, reduced the deficit in the 75th minute through captain Kipre Tchetche.

JDT regained their two-goal lead three minutes through Da Silva.

It was JDT's second FA Cup title after their 2016 success and also their 20th overall crown.
